The LG V30 is a little bit better than the LG Q7, getting a overall score of 79.1 against 72.2. The LG V30 design is somewhat thinner but a little heavier than LG Q7, and they were released only 9 months apart. LG V30 counts with a bit superior CPU than LG Q7, and although they both have 8 cores, the LG V30 also has more RAM memory.
LG V30 counts with a bit sharper screen than LG Q7, because it has a little bit bigger display, a just a bit greater pixels quantity in each display inch and a better resolution of 1440 x 2880 pixels. LG V30 has much more memory capacity for applications and games than LG Q7, because it has 64 GB internal memory capacity and a slot for an external memory card that holds a maximum of 1,95 TB.
The LG V30 counts with just a bit better battery life than LG Q7, because it has 3300mAh of battery capacity. LG V30 counts with a superior camera than LG Q7, because although it has a smaller back camera sensor capturing less light and dull colors, it also counts with a much better (4K) video quality, a way bigger camera aperture and a better resolution camera.
